Everyone knows how important role Twitter can play to bring new visitors to your site, and Tweet to unlock can only amplify the whole thing by requiring visitors to Tweet about your page in order to unlock the downloadable items or premium content. In this tutorial article, let’s create simple “Tweet to Unlock” feature for your web page using jQuery Ajax and PHP.
Events are triggered when user successfully tweets the page, to capture some information from Twitter, we can add a “listeners” to the actions users perform in Web Intents. Once we know the user has Twitted the page, we can make an Ajax request to a PHP file, which will respond to this request by sending the unlocked data to user browser. Here’s complete code example of a page which has some content to be unlocked by Twitting.
PHP Ajax Response
When user Tweets the page successfully, an Ajax request is made to PHP file send_resources.php, and the server returns this HTML snippet, which contains unlocked item or anything goes wrong HTTP error is sent to browser.
This is the example usage of Twitter Web Intents, and I found there are some limitations to what you can achieve with it, but I am sure it will serve the purpose and if there’s more to it let’s dig and share, good luck!
The link to downloadable sample code is locked, Please Tweet this page to unlock it.